How many 5 gallon buckets are in a yard of concrete?

There are 202 gallons in a cubic yard. So if you completely fill a 5 gallon bucket up, it would take approximately 40 of those buckets to make up a yard.

How long does it take for a 5 gallon bucket of cement to dry?

But to answer the question of, “How long does concrete take to set?” concrete setting time is generally 24 to 48 hours. At this point the neighborhood dog will not leave his footprints in it, but you should keep it clear of heavy equipment during this time period. Most mixes are cured at 28 days.

Does concrete get lighter in weight as it dries?

Concrete weighs around 3900 pounds per cubic yard but can drop to 3500 pounds per cubic yard after the concrete dries. … Some weights can go up to 300 pounds per cubic foot, while others can be as low as 100 pounds per cubic foot.

How long does a bucket of concrete take to dry?

Concrete typically takes 24 to 48 hours to dry enough for you to walk or drive on it. However, concrete drying is a continuous and fluid event, and usually reaches its full effective strength after about 28 days.

How many pounds is a 5 gallon water jug?

A US gallon is 8.34 pounds-mass of water, so a US five-gallon bottle of water weighs 41.7 pounds-force plus the weight of the bottle.

Do you have to mix quikrete?

Whether you are building a new fence, setting a mailbox or anchoring a basketball goal or play set, QUIKRETE® Fast-Setting Concrete is the ideal product for the job. With Fast-Setting Concrete there is no mixing or tools required – You simply pour the dry mix right from the bag into the hole, then add water.

How much water do you add to quikrete?

Just don’t use salt water. Salt will weaken your concrete. The correct ratio of water to Quikrete mix is 3 quarts of water for each 80 pound bag. Pro Tip: Measure out your water the first time and then pour it into a 5 gallon bucket.
